Transaction 34af5b78cecc24af94d7852421684dbda510d0ebdf6794c6da0bd4ed67121d08
1 Input
1 Output
-
34af5b78cecc24af94d7852421684dbda510d0ebdf6794c6da0bd4ed67121d08:0
- value
- 974470
- script pubkey
- OP_0 OP_PUSHBYTES_20 590801cc8990b8ff6a071a5f564132712f2a4294
- address
- bc1qtyyqrnyfjzu076s8rf04vsfjwyhj5s558xw73c